Analysis

The most recent figure for ipcc agriculture — emissions share in Oman is 49.39 %, measured in 2023.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 0.3% on the previous year and down 1.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, ipcc agriculture — emissions share in Oman peaked at 58.67 % in 2005 and was at its lowest, 48.38 %, in 2019.

Oman ranks 160th of 209 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 34 years of available data.

The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ions indicators disseminates indicators on sectoral shares of total national gre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ions as well as three indicators of emissions intensity: per capita emissions; emissions per value of agricultural production; and emissions per area of agricultural land.
